Server Colocation in our private datacenter in Sacramento, CA

  • 24/7 Hour Network Monitoring
  • Redundant Climate Control
  • Video Security
  • 24/7 Keycard Access for our customers
  • Redundant multi-Gigabit internet connections
  • Roof rights available (Call for quote)
  • Very Flexible on hosting unusual servers or equipment
  • Not near a earthquake fault lines like Bay Area data centers
  • Well above the flood plain (on 2nd story) unlike Natomas data centers.

Low Prices for Sacramento Server Co-location. We will match or beat any local data center!

Host your server at our 1100 sq ft private downtown Sacramento Datacenter located at 1112 I street, Sacramento, CA 95814.  We are in an on-net building for many major Tier 1 internet providers and can offer up to gigabit internet access. We are now part of Integra Telecom Sacramento fiber Sonet ring network.

You can host (Colocate) servers of all shapes and sizes, they do not need to be rack mountable. State and local agencies, as well as many web companies, rely on the CWO Colocation facilities. Consider Colocation as the most cost-effective way to serve the large databases, web applications, and fastest web sites to your clients.  Host your own server with us, get a new server from us (buy or rent), or let us convert your Windows or Linux server to a VMware virtual server on a redundant system.

  • Per U

    $75 / mo
    • 1 IP Address
    • 1A/110V
    • 1U rack space
    • $50 Setup
  • 1/4 Rack

    $200 / mo
    • 8 IP Address
    • 5A/110V
    • Optional locked 1/4 cabinet
    • $100 Setup
  • 1/2 Rack

    $350 / mo
    • 16 IP Address
    • 10A/110V
    • Optional locked 1/2 Cabinet
    • $250 Setup
  • Full Rack

    $500 / mo
    • 32 IP Address
    • 20A/110V
    • Locking cabinet
    • $400 Setup
Server Bandwidth Options :

  1. Shared 100Mbit circuit $100/per TB of traffic
  2. Dedicated bandwidth as low as $10/Mbit
  3. Extra IPs (Block of 8) – $10 / mo

Onsite server admin – only $100/hr for Windows or UNIX server administration, help with reboots, drive swaps, power cycling equipment, troubleshooting OS problems, etc.
